From a9d538da2488be90e71f530812b40ccf59e1b7af Mon Sep 17 00:00:00 2001 From: Aleksander <170264518+t-aleksander@users.noreply.github.com> Date: Mon, 27 Apr 2026 12:25:07 +0200 Subject: [PATCH 1/3] expose more ports --- docker-compose2.0/docker-compose.firewall.yaml | 5 ++++- docker-compose2.0/docker-compose.ha.yaml | 1 + docker-compose2.0/docker-compose.ldap.yaml | 9 ++++++--- docker-compose2.0/docker-compose.setup.yaml | 3 +++ docker-compose2.0/docker-compose.yaml | 3 +++ 5 files changed, 17 insertions(+), 4 deletions(-) diff --git a/docker-compose2.0/docker-compose.firewall.yaml b/docker-compose2.0/docker-compose.firewall.yaml index 38e917b..f2859d5 100644 --- a/docker-compose2.0/docker-compose.firewall.yaml +++ b/docker-compose2.0/docker-compose.firewall.yaml @@ -21,6 +21,7 @@ services: - edge1 ports: - "8000:8000" + - "8443:443" networks: - default @@ -30,6 +31,8 @@ services: - ./.volumes/certs2.0/edge1:/etc/defguard/certs ports: - "8080:8080" + - "80:80" + - "443:443" networks: - default @@ -82,4 +85,4 @@ networks: driver: bridge ipam: config: - - subnet: 10.10.20.0/24 \ No newline at end of file + - subnet: 10.10.20.0/24 diff --git a/docker-compose2.0/docker-compose.ha.yaml b/docker-compose2.0/docker-compose.ha.yaml index 306d04c..0fa9dce 100644 --- a/docker-compose2.0/docker-compose.ha.yaml +++ b/docker-compose2.0/docker-compose.ha.yaml @@ -20,6 +20,7 @@ services: - edge-lb ports: - "8000:8000" + - "8443:443" edge1: image: ghcr.io/defguard/defguard-proxy:2.0.0-alpha2 diff --git a/docker-compose2.0/docker-compose.ldap.yaml b/docker-compose2.0/docker-compose.ldap.yaml index 55b0564..3f1ea20 100644 --- a/docker-compose2.0/docker-compose.ldap.yaml +++ b/docker-compose2.0/docker-compose.ldap.yaml @@ -20,6 +20,7 @@ services: - edge1 ports: - "8000:8000" + - "8443:443" edge1: image: ghcr.io/defguard/defguard-proxy:2.0.0-alpha2 @@ -27,6 +28,8 @@ services: - ./.volumes/certs2.0/edge1:/etc/defguard/certs ports: - "8080:8080" + - "80:80" + - "443:443" gateway1: image: ghcr.io/defguard/gateway:2.0.0-alpha2 @@ -53,8 +56,8 @@ services: image: axllent/mailpit:latest container_name: mailpit ports: - - "8025:8025" # web UI - - "1025:1025" # SMTP + - "8025:8025" # web UI + - "1025:1025" # SMTP openldap: image: bitnamilegacy/openldap:2.6 @@ -79,4 +82,4 @@ services: PHPLDAPADMIN_LDAP_HOSTS: "#PYTHON2BASH:[{'openldap': [{'server': [{'host': 'openldap', 'port': 1389}]}]}]" PHPLDAPADMIN_HTTPS: "false" ports: - - "8081:80" + - "8081:80" diff --git a/docker-compose2.0/docker-compose.setup.yaml b/docker-compose2.0/docker-compose.setup.yaml index 0c7561a..542913e 100644 --- a/docker-compose2.0/docker-compose.setup.yaml +++ b/docker-compose2.0/docker-compose.setup.yaml @@ -14,6 +14,7 @@ services: - gateway ports: - "8000:8000" + - "8443:443" edge: restart: unless-stopped @@ -23,6 +24,8 @@ services: - ./.volumes/certs/edge:/etc/defguard/certs ports: - "8080:8080" + - "443:443" + - "80:80" gateway: restart: unless-stopped diff --git a/docker-compose2.0/docker-compose.yaml b/docker-compose2.0/docker-compose.yaml index 3e62dda..b78b202 100644 --- a/docker-compose2.0/docker-compose.yaml +++ b/docker-compose2.0/docker-compose.yaml @@ -20,6 +20,7 @@ services: - edge1 ports: - "8000:8000" + - "8443:443" edge1: image: ghcr.io/defguard/defguard-proxy:2.0.0-alpha2 @@ -27,6 +28,8 @@ services: - ./.volumes/certs2.0/edge1:/etc/defguard/certs ports: - "8080:8080" + - "80:80" + - "443:443" gateway1: image: ghcr.io/defguard/gateway:2.0.0-alpha2 From ea13a6734a3d7347d151e2e2e2e95ab88b02125b Mon Sep 17 00:00:00 2001 From: Aleksander <170264518+t-aleksander@users.noreply.github.com> Date: Mon, 27 Apr 2026 13:03:27 +0200 Subject: [PATCH 2/3] ova --- ova/files/docker-compose.standalone.yaml | 3 +++ ova/files/docker-compose.yaml | 3 +++ 2 files changed, 6 insertions(+) diff --git a/ova/files/docker-compose.standalone.yaml b/ova/files/docker-compose.standalone.yaml index bdb5809..d8254b6 100644 --- a/ova/files/docker-compose.standalone.yaml +++ b/ova/files/docker-compose.standalone.yaml @@ -11,6 +11,7 @@ services: - db ports: - "8000:8000" + - "8443:443" edge: restart: unless-stopped @@ -21,6 +22,8 @@ services: ports: - "8080:8080" - "50051:50051" + - "443:443" + - "80:80" gateway: restart: unless-stopped diff --git a/ova/files/docker-compose.yaml b/ova/files/docker-compose.yaml index 60fef05..dcff9f5 100644 --- a/ova/files/docker-compose.yaml +++ b/ova/files/docker-compose.yaml @@ -16,6 +16,7 @@ services: - gateway ports: - "8000:8000" + - "8443:443" edge: restart: unless-stopped @@ -24,6 +25,8 @@ services: - ./.volumes/certs/edge:/etc/defguard/certs ports: - "8080:8080" + - "443:443" + - "80:80" gateway: restart: unless-stopped From 0a19f0e30d332372d395fa2f4b521ab99d2e3b26 Mon Sep 17 00:00:00 2001 From: Aleksander <170264518+t-aleksander@users.noreply.github.com> Date: Mon, 27 Apr 2026 15:57:24 +0200 Subject: [PATCH 3/3] dont expose core ports --- docker-compose2.0/docker-compose.firewall.yaml | 1 - docker-compose2.0/docker-compose.ha.yaml | 1 - docker-compose2.0/docker-compose.ldap.yaml | 1 - docker-compose2.0/docker-compose.setup.yaml | 1 - docker-compose2.0/docker-compose.yaml | 1 - ova/files/docker-compose.standalone.yaml | 1 - ova/files/docker-compose.yaml | 1 - 7 files changed, 7 deletions(-) diff --git a/docker-compose2.0/docker-compose.firewall.yaml b/docker-compose2.0/docker-compose.firewall.yaml index f2859d5..e8b212c 100644 --- a/docker-compose2.0/docker-compose.firewall.yaml +++ b/docker-compose2.0/docker-compose.firewall.yaml @@ -21,7 +21,6 @@ services: - edge1 ports: - "8000:8000" - - "8443:443" networks: - default diff --git a/docker-compose2.0/docker-compose.ha.yaml b/docker-compose2.0/docker-compose.ha.yaml index 0fa9dce..306d04c 100644 --- a/docker-compose2.0/docker-compose.ha.yaml +++ b/docker-compose2.0/docker-compose.ha.yaml @@ -20,7 +20,6 @@ services: - edge-lb ports: - "8000:8000" - - "8443:443" edge1: image: ghcr.io/defguard/defguard-proxy:2.0.0-alpha2 diff --git a/docker-compose2.0/docker-compose.ldap.yaml b/docker-compose2.0/docker-compose.ldap.yaml index 3f1ea20..176ddad 100644 --- a/docker-compose2.0/docker-compose.ldap.yaml +++ b/docker-compose2.0/docker-compose.ldap.yaml @@ -20,7 +20,6 @@ services: - edge1 ports: - "8000:8000" - - "8443:443" edge1: image: ghcr.io/defguard/defguard-proxy:2.0.0-alpha2 diff --git a/docker-compose2.0/docker-compose.setup.yaml b/docker-compose2.0/docker-compose.setup.yaml index 542913e..85a418d 100644 --- a/docker-compose2.0/docker-compose.setup.yaml +++ b/docker-compose2.0/docker-compose.setup.yaml @@ -14,7 +14,6 @@ services: - gateway ports: - "8000:8000" - - "8443:443" edge: restart: unless-stopped diff --git a/docker-compose2.0/docker-compose.yaml b/docker-compose2.0/docker-compose.yaml index b78b202..c274b85 100644 --- a/docker-compose2.0/docker-compose.yaml +++ b/docker-compose2.0/docker-compose.yaml @@ -20,7 +20,6 @@ services: - edge1 ports: - "8000:8000" - - "8443:443" edge1: image: ghcr.io/defguard/defguard-proxy:2.0.0-alpha2 diff --git a/ova/files/docker-compose.standalone.yaml b/ova/files/docker-compose.standalone.yaml index d8254b6..3559385 100644 --- a/ova/files/docker-compose.standalone.yaml +++ b/ova/files/docker-compose.standalone.yaml @@ -11,7 +11,6 @@ services: - db ports: - "8000:8000" - - "8443:443" edge: restart: unless-stopped diff --git a/ova/files/docker-compose.yaml b/ova/files/docker-compose.yaml index dcff9f5..6995861 100644 --- a/ova/files/docker-compose.yaml +++ b/ova/files/docker-compose.yaml @@ -16,7 +16,6 @@ services: - gateway ports: - "8000:8000" - - "8443:443" edge: restart: unless-stopped